Client Background

The client is a young female aged between 20 and 25, currently at the early stage of her career. She intends to apply for Australian immigration through investment, hoping to gain a broader platform for development and a better living environment. However, the recent increase in the Australian government's investment immigration threshold has pressured her to reassess her departure timing and preparation plan.

She is currently in the eighth year of the Ji Wei (己未) Da Yun (decade luck cycle), which brings relatively stable fortune, suitable for maintaining achievements and accumulating resources. She aims to find the most secure departure window in her immigration decision to avoid investment failure or visa issues caused by threshold changes, ensuring smooth settlement and future development.

BaZi Chart Structure Interpretation

The client's Day Master (日主) is Gui Water (癸水), which is relatively weak overall. Her Four Pillars form a Pian Cai (偏财) pattern, indicating that her wealth and resources mainly depend on external opportunities and support from others. She is suited to enhance her quality of life through investment and financial management. Her Yong Shen (favorable element) is Metal, which generates Water and nourishes the Day Master; therefore, her actions and decisions should focus on environments and timings that supplement the Metal element.

Regarding Ji Shen (unfavorable elements), Wood and Fire exert pressure on her. Wood overcomes Metal, and Fire directly consumes the Day Master's Water energy, representing potential disturbances and depletion. Although the current Ji Wei (己未) Da Yun belongs to Earth (Wei), offering a stable fortune conducive to preservation and steady progress, the current Liu Nian (annual fortune) is Bing Wu (丙午), a Fire element year, reminding her to cautiously handle possible changes and challenges, especially avoiding risks related to interpersonal relations and capital caused by excessive Fire.

The Hour Pillar reveals Ren Zi (壬子) Water, providing some support to the relatively weak Day Master, but overall Water energy remains insufficient, further emphasizing the importance of the Yong Shen Metal. Considering these BaZi characteristics, the client should prioritize departure timings that enhance Metal and avoid years when Wood and Fire are strong to ensure smooth actions.

Focused Issue Assessment

In response to the recent increase in the Australian investment immigration threshold, the client needs to identify the best departure timing that aligns with her BaZi chart and adapts to external policy changes. Since the current Ji Wei (己未) Da Yun is stable and suitable for preservation, she should avoid rash actions. Particularly during the Fire-strong Bing Wu (丙午) Liu Nian, she must remain cautious and flexible to avoid the depletion risks brought by Fire.

From the Yong Shen perspective, departure timing should be chosen in years or months with strong Metal energy to supplement the Day Master's needed Metal element, enhancing the smoothness and success rate of her actions. Metal corresponds to Shen (申) and You (酉) in the Earthly Branches, and to Geng (庚) and Xin (辛) in the Heavenly Stems. Future Liu Nian or Da Yun periods rich in Metal should be key references for departure timing.

Additionally, the client should avoid periods with abundant Wood and Fire, as these Ji Shen elements may cause plan obstructions or capital liquidity risks. Under the context of policy threshold adjustments, strong Fire years tend to exacerbate obstacles. Therefore, avoiding immediate departure during the Bing Wu (丙午) Liu Nian or Wood-strong years and instead waiting for the next Metal-strong period will be more favorable for smooth investment and immigration.

Analyzing the interaction between Da Yun and Liu Nian, the Ji Wei (己未) Da Yun is overall stable, with hidden Metal in the Wei Earth. If a Shen or You Metal-strong Liu Nian occurs in the next one or two years, the client's action capability and resources will be strengthened, making that the most secure time to depart.

Recommended Actions and Timing Nodes

Based on the above analysis, the client should prepare in advance and officially depart after entering a Metal-strong Liu Nian. In the near term, she can utilize the stability of the Ji Wei (己未) Da Yun period to consolidate funds and networks, improve the quality and compliance of investment projects, and avoid rushing that might lead to risks from policy changes.

Specifically, the client can focus on Shen (申) or You (酉) years or months containing Metal, such as Shen month or You month, as departure windows. If conditions permit, waiting for the next Metal-strong Da Yun or Liu Nian, such as Xin You (辛酉) year, will better resist external uncertainties and ensure smooth immigration procedures and investments.

Furthermore, during the Bing Wu (丙午) Liu Nian, the client should moderately adjust her strategy, maintain flexibility, and avoid over-investment. After the Fire energy subsides and Metal energy strengthens, she can concentrate resources for a full effort. This pacing adjustment not only mitigates risks but also maximizes success by leveraging BaZi advantages.

Review and Reminders

A common pitfall in the client's immigration process is neglecting the dynamic coordination between external policies and her BaZi chart. Acting too early or hastily may trigger the Ji Shen Wood and Fire, causing dual losses in capital and opportunities. It is crucial to avoid blindly initiating plans in Fire-strong years to prevent investment failure or visa issues due to poor timing.

At the same time, BaZi is only an auxiliary decision-making tool. Actual immigration also requires detailed legal consultation and financial planning. It is recommended that the client combine BaZi advice with steady progress, prepare multiple contingency plans, and flexibly adjust to policy changes to achieve a smooth immigration process in a complex environment.
